Opel announced a new Mokka Electric model year 2025 with a slight change in the design and more streamlined configurations. The new Mokka now comes in only one variant - with 115 kW output and 54 kWh battery.

Previously, the Opel Mokka Electric was offered in two configurations: a 50 kWh battery with a 136 hp (100 kW) motor and a 54 kWh battery with a 156 hp (115 kW) motor. Now, only the latter remains.

Opel has also revised its pricing, and the new Mokka is cheaper than the older one with the same drivetrain. It's now asking €36,740, which is €7,980 discount. However, it still costs €4,060 more than the older base model.

Due to Stellantis' recent strategy shift, the Opel Mokka's trim options have also been reduced. While Elegance and GS offered the smaller motor and the Ultimate package boasted the 115 kW drivetrain, the Mokka is now available only in Edition and GS trims. There are no technical changes to the drivetrain.

In addition to the barely noticeable design changes, there are a few more sensible interior updates. The steering wheel is now different with a flat bottom, the seats feature new fabric with recycled materials, the central console and its display are revamped. You can get a 10-inch driver display and a large central screen running the latest version of the infotainment software.
